Arabic Language

Spoken language
Arabic is a Central Semitic language of the Afroasiatic language family spoken primarily in the Arab world. The ISO assigns language codes to 32 varieties of Arabic, including its standard form of Literary Arabic, known as Modern Standard Arabic,... Wikipedia
Early forms: Proto-Afroasiatic: Proto-Semitic > Proto-Arabic > Old Arabic > Pre-classical Arabic
Ethnicity: Arabs and several other peoples of the Middle East and North Africa
Native to: Arab world and surrounding regions
Signed forms: Signed Arabic (different national forms)
Speakers: 380 million native speakers of all varieties (2024); 330 million L2 users of Modern Standard Arabic (2023)
